What they do

A Switchboard or Telephone Operator works for a telephone company or system to operate telephone system equipment to route incoming calls, direct internal calls, or assist customers with placing calls. Assists with connecting long distance or collect calls, or provides customers with assistance in finding a phone number or an address. May also answer customer calls at a company or organization or work for an agency that handles and routes emergency calls.

Job Description

Job Description Southwest University is seeking a professional and reliable Communications Hub Operator to serve as the first point of contact for incoming calls to the university. This role functions as a central communication hub, ensuring calls are answered promptly, routed correctly, and handled with a high level of customer service. The Communications Hub Operator provides general information, directs inquiries to the appropriate departments, and supports smooth communication across the campus. This position is ideal for someone who is organized, calm under pressure, and enjoys helping others. Responsibilities Answer and manage a high volume of incoming calls in a courteous and professional manner Route calls accurately to the appropriate departments, staff, or offices Provide general university information (office hours, department contacts, campus directions, etc.) Take and relay messages when staff or departments are unavailable Monitor and manage the main phone lines to ensure minimal wait times Maintain updated contact lists and department directories Assist with internal communication needs, including call transfers Record call notes or inquiries in university systems as needed Support students, faculty, staff, and external callers with professionalism and patience Escalate urgent or sensitive calls to the appropriate personnel Follow university policies related to privacy and confidentiality Participate in training to stay updated on campus departments and procedures Qualifications High school diploma or equivalent (Associate's degree preferred) Experience in customer service, reception, or administrative support Clear and professional phone etiquette Strong communication and listening skills Ability to stay calm and helpful in a fast-paced environment Good organizational and multitasking skills Basic computer skills and familiarity with phone systems Dependable, punctual, and detail-oriented Team-oriented mindset with a service-focused attitude This role plays an important part in creating a positive first impression of Southwest University. The Communications Hub Operator helps ensure callers receive accurate information and are connected to the right people efficiently.
